An item specifically designed to be placed around that portion of a connector,receptable,electrical or connector,plug,electrical which contains the facilities for attaching wires or cables. It may be designed to provide the nesessary accomodations between an electrical cable clamping device and an electrical connector shell or it may include the clamping device. It may be used for shielding against electrical interference, mechanical injury or physical damage due to environmental conditions.
